ABOUT YOU

You will have experience working with ultrasonic inspection systems and a background in engineering and/or NDT. You'll be a reliable team player with a strong attention to detail, capable of working accurately to procedures and techniques within a fast-paced environment. The ideal candidate will have ultrasonic qualifications such as NAS410 or PCN, good computer literacy, and a solid understanding of the field.
